94303135433055360 is an even compos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two thousand, eight hundred eighty divisors.

Prime factorization of 94303135433055360:

27 × 3 × 5 × 7 × 232 × 412 × 534

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 5 × 7 × 23 × 23 × 41 × 41 × 53 × 53 × 53 × 53)
